    What type of optical cable is best for duct laying

    To choose the right duct fiber optic cable, consider installation environment, mechanical protection requirements, fiber type, and future scalability. Armored cables are best for harsh conditions, while microduct solutions are ideal for FTTH and expandable networks.     South Sudan Telecommunication Tower

    The national government has approved the installation of two new telecommunications towers in Jonglei State as part of efforts to improve communication and strengthen security across the region. Despite this progress, South Sudan remains one of the least connected countries globally, with limited infrastructure, high costs, and significant rural–urban disparities in access.
